ABOUT HA BREWING

Just outside the mountain town of Eureka, Montana, in the shadows of Glacier National Park, and situated on a fully functioning farmstead, is the H.A. Brewing microbrewery and tap room. It all started six years ago when Chris Neill - founder, owner, general manager, and brewmaster - started brewing beer on his farm for his family and friends. Chris brewed out of love for community, delicious small-batch beer, and crafting. After some encouragement from friends and family, and with the inspiration of Montana's very active micro-brewing scene, Chris decided to turn his passion into the family business.

Along with his wife and two sons, and his partners, Andy and Karl, Chris built the business right there on the family homestead. The taproom feels like the family room and the beer garden feels like the front porch. Chris and his partners pride themselves on serving up delicious, finely-crafted beer in both traditional and experimental styles. What started as a crafting project for gatherings of friends and family on the homestead has turned into a community gathering place, serving some of the best beers and most beautiful views in the West.

    - Join the Northwest Montana Forest Fire Lookout Association and HA0 Brewing Co. to help raise funds for the restoration and maintanance of Mount Wam Lookout located on the kootenai National Forest in the Ten Lakes Scenic Area.

    - Built in 1930 , Mount Wam Lookout sits atop its namesake mountain at an elevation of 7,203 feet. The Lookout was regularly used as an observation point for spotting forest fires between 1931 and 1951. It was last restored in 1999 and current restoration efforts were rekindled in 2017.

    -The Northwest Montana Chapter of the Forest Fire Lookout Association, Inc. is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ization dedicated to supporting Federal and State agencies in the restoration, maintainance and staffing of fire lookouts and other historic support structures on public lands.
